Princess Cave, or Tham Phra Nang Nok, is not just a simple cave; it is a mesmerizing blend of natural wonder and cultural significance. Located in the breathtaking Railay Peninsula of Krabi, this cave is accessible only by boat, adding to its allure. As you approach, the towering limestone cliffs rise dramatically from the turquoise waters, creating a striking backdrop for your visit. Inside, you’ll discover a sacred shrine dedicated to Phra Nang, the goddess of the sea, adorned with colorful offerings and intricately carved figures. This cave is a spiritual haven for local fishermen who come to pay their respects and seek protection for their journeys at sea. The cave’s beauty is heightened by its surroundings, where soft sands and gentle waves invite visitors to bask in the sun or take a refreshing dip. The area is also known for its vibrant marine life, making it a popular spot for snorkeling and swimming. As you wander through the cave, take a moment to appreciate the intricate rock formations and the serene atmosphere that envelops this hidden gem. The stunning views from the nearby cliffs offer unparalleled photo opportunities, especially during sunset when the sky is painted in hues of orange and pink. For those seeking adventure, the cliffs surrounding Princess Cave are perfect for rock climbing, boasting routes for both beginners and seasoned climbers. The combination of adventure, spirituality, and natural beauty makes Princess Cave a must-visit destination in Krabi, offering a unique experience that enriches your travel journey.

Local tips

  • Visit early in the morning or late afternoon to avoid crowds and enjoy a more tranquil experience.
  • Bring water and snacks, as there are limited facilities nearby.
  • Wear suitable footwear for rocky paths and consider bringing a camera for stunning photos.
  • Be respectful of the local customs and do not disturb the offerings inside the cave.
  • Check tide schedules, as access can be limited during high tide.

Getting There

  • Car

    If you're driving from Ao Nang, take the Route 4203 towards Krabi Town. After about 15 minutes, you'll reach Ao Nam Mao intersection. Here, follow signs for Railay Beach. You'll need to park at Ao Nam Mao Pier, as there are no roads leading directly to Railay. Parking fees vary, typically around 20-50 THB per hour. From the pier, take a long-tail boat to Railay Beach; the boat fare is approximately 100-150 THB per person. The ride takes about 15 minutes.

  • Public Transportation

    To reach Railay Beach via public transport, board a local songthaew (shared taxi) from Ao Nang to Ao Nam Mao Pier. The fare is usually around 60-100 THB per person and takes about 30 minutes. Once at the pier, take a long-tail boat to Railay Beach (costing 100-150 THB per person) for a 15-minute journey. Ensure to check the boat schedules, especially in the low season, as they may vary.

  • Walking

    Once you arrive at Railay Beach, you can walk towards Princess Cave, which is located on the east side of Railay. The cave is about a 10-15 minute walk along the beach. Follow the signs, and enjoy the scenery as you make your way there.
